Indictment charging defendant with robbery, conspiracy, theft and weapons offenses. Before BLAKE, J. Verdict of guilty and judgment of sentence entered. Defendant appealed. Appeal, No. 1864, Oct. T., 1976, from Court of Common Pleas, Trial Division, of Philadelphia, Dec. T., 1975, Nos. 1305 and 1308. Submitted December 6, 1976.

Ronald J. Brockington, for appellant; Steven H. Goldblatt and Deborah E. Glass, Assistant District Attorneys, and F. Emmett Fitzpatrick, District Attorney, for Commonwealth, appellee.


Judgment of sentence affirmed.
